Innate Pharma prices private placement of new shares at EUR 1.7 each
Reuters2026/08/19 20:03- Innate Pharma launched a capital increase without preferential rights, issuing new ordinary shares at EUR 1.7 each.
- U.S. tranche structured as a private placement to Rule 144A QIBs, relying on the Securities Act Section 4(a)(2) exemption.
- Closing set for Aug. 18, 2026 at 8:30 a.m. CET, with investor cash due in euros by wire.
- Shares to be delivered in bearer form through Stifel as centralizing agent, with Société Générale Securities Services as registrar.
- New shares expected to be listed on Euronext Paris on the closing date, subject to official issuance notice.
